With that in mind, a few common questions we receive from merchants is: With consumers increasing moving towards a cash-free lifestyle, businesses must accept different payment methods if they want to stay competitive. So not only do consumers spend more with cards than cash but they spend with them more often. While card spending has almost always accounted for the majority of retail spending, this was the first year that credit and debit also accounted for more than half of all retail transactions.
